What makes Antioch an unique solar market

Antioch beings in a component of California where solar still makes sense, but the factors have moved. A few years back, the conversation was virtually entirely concerning offsetting daytime electricity use and exporting excess manufacturing back to the grid. Now the business economics depend far more on self-consumption, evening use patterns, and whether a battery aids you keep even more of your very own power. That indicates the very best regional installer is not necessarily the one providing the biggest system. It is typically the one that designs around how your family in fact makes use of energy.

I have seen property owners obtain impressed by production price quotes without realizing their roofing has problematic west-facing areas, seasonal shielding from fully grown trees, or a primary service panel that requires an upgrade prior to affiliation. On paper, two quotes can look comparable. In practice, one might include electric job, reasonable presumptions, and quality solution gain access to, while the various other silently presses those costs and headaches downstream.

Antioch also has the sensible facts common to East Bay and wider Northern The golden state jobs: allowing timelines can vary, energy coordination can drag, and older homes in some cases expose surprises once the staff opens attic room accessibility or examines roofing framework carefully. Great solar companies antioch home owners count on have a tendency to be the ones that prepare customers for those truths as opposed to pretending every little thing will certainly be frictionless.

The very first blunder house owners make

The most common blunder is going shopping on rate alone. The second is presuming every quote stands for the same product.

Solar propositions frequently pack with each other tools, labor, design, allowing, affiliation assistance, service warranties, and funding in manner ins which make straight contrasts tough. A lower price per watt might conceal weak panel output, much less knowledgeable installers, outsourced crews, thinner handiwork protection, or vague language around service calls. On the flip side, the greatest quote is not immediately the best one. Some bigger brands charge a costs primarily because they have strong marketing and broad recognition.

A valuable means to consider it is this: you are not buying panels, you are buying a system and the firm backing up it. Panels matter, inverters issue, batteries matter, yet company integrity matters equally as much. If an inverter fails in year 9, the worth of your guarantee relies on whether a person responds to the phone and actually handles the replacement.

What a solid quote should include

A serious proposition should offer you sufficient detail to compare more than monthly settlement quotes. If the sales rep invests the majority of the meeting talking about "totally free solar" or only about financing, reduce the procedure down. You desire a scope of work that stands up when permits are drawn and staffs arrive.

An excellent quote normally define the panel brand and wattage, inverter type, estimated yearly production, assumptions about shading, roof covering design, warranty structure, financing terms if relevant, and whether crucial items like electrical upgrades, critter guard, surveillance, and battery integration are included or optional. It should also specify whether the firm makes use of internal installers or farmed out crews. That is not a deal breaker on its own, but it alters accountability.

One proposition might look slightly more pricey because it includes a primary panel upgrade and attic room channel directing, while an additional leaves out both and plans to charge change orders later. That takes place more frequently than house owners anticipate. The most inexpensive quote is sometimes simply the least total quote.

Questions worth asking before you sign

The best conversations with solar providers tend to get details fast. General promises are easy. Details responses expose competence.

  • Who performs the website inspection, and does the last system layout adjustment afterwards visit?
  • Are setup crews in-house or subcontracted, and who handles warranty service later?
  • What presumptions are built right into the manufacturing estimate for shade, weather condition, and panel degradation?
  • If my roof or electrical panel requires job, just how is that priced and coordinated?
  • If I include a battery now or later, what tools and circuitry options today will certainly make that easier?

Those 5 concerns expose an unexpected quantity. A seasoned installer can answer them cleanly. A weak sales operation typically pivots back to regular monthly savings instead.

Financing transforms the math, occasionally dramatically

Two homes can buy nearly the same systems and have really various outcomes depending upon financing. Cash money purchases typically produce the clearest business economics with time. Loans can still function well, however origination charges, supplier costs, rates of interest, and prepayment presumptions issue. Leases and power acquisition arrangements may lower upfront prices, yet they introduce transfer problems if you market your house and may reduce long-term savings.

This is where lots of solar business near me search engine result blur with each other since the ad duplicate seems the same. The distinction appears when you request for the cash money price, the financed rate, overall payments over the life of the financing, and any presumptions around tax credit ratings. A reliable firm will certainly not hide behind regular monthly payment advertising and marketing. They will certainly reveal the actual numbers.

It is likewise worth keeping in mind that some homeowners do better by right-sizing a system instead of making the most of outcome. If funding a bigger system stretches the spending plan or produces excess power you can not use effectively, the "bigger is better" reasoning breaks down. The most effective solar providers are generally comfortable advising a smaller system if it fits the home a lot more intelligently.

Roof condition, electrical work, and various other unglamorous realities

The unglamorous components of a solar job are commonly the most crucial. Roofing age matters. A 20-plus-year-old roofing system that might need substitute soon is a problem if you are about to mount a solar array in addition to it. Yes, panels can be eliminated and re-installed later, yet that includes cost and trouble. An honest installer ought to raise the concern prior to you have to.

Electrical panel capacity matters too. Older homes in Antioch may require upgrades, subpanel changes, or tons estimations that influence job extent. If you are also considering an EV charger, electric water heater, or heat pump, ground-mounted solar panels the solar design must not take place alone. Great companies assume in regards to whole-home electrification, also if you just mount component of that strategy now.

And then there are aesthetic appeals and practical information. Avenue runs, attic gain access to, noticeable hardware, and positioning of battery equipment all affect satisfaction after the set up. Individuals bear in mind how much they conserved. They also bear in mind whether the completed system looks clean from the street and whether the crew valued the property.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Providers in Antioch, CA


Why are people getting rid of their solar panels in Antioch?

Some homeowners remove solar panels because of roof replacement, renovations, aging equipment, or changing electricity needs. Others replace older systems with newer equipment that provides greater efficiency or capacity. Leases, financing agreements, installer closures, and maintenance considerations can also influence removal decisions. Most modern solar panels are designed to remain operational for decades.

What is the 20% rule for solar in Antioch?

There is no universal solar regulation officially known as the 20% rule. The phrase may refer to a system-sizing guideline, financing calculation, or allowance for future electricity use or system losses. Solar installations instead must comply with applicable electrical codes and utility interconnection requirements. The intended meaning depends on the context in which the term is used.

Is solar worth it anymore in Antioch?

Solar can still be financially worthwhile for households with suitable roofs and substantial electricity consumption. The financial return depends on installation cost, financing, utility rates, system production, and how much solar electricity is consumed directly. Battery storage can increase self-consumption but also raises the initial cost. Payback periods vary considerably between households.

Is solar really cheaper than electricity in Antioch?

Solar electricity can cost less over a system's lifetime than purchasing all electricity from the grid, but savings are not guaranteed. The outcome depends on installation price, financing costs, system production, household consumption, and future utility rates. Electricity consumed directly from solar panels may provide greater financial value than electricity exported to the grid. Lifetime costs provide a better comparison than upfront price alone.

What I wish I knew before getting solar panels in Antioch?

Important factors to understand before installing solar include system sizing, roof condition, financing terms, utility billing rules, and warranty coverage. Expected electricity production should be compared with actual household consumption before selecting a system. Battery storage can increase energy independence but also adds significant cost. Future roof repairs may require temporary removal and reinstallation of the panels.

Can a house run 100% on solar in Antioch?

A house can potentially generate enough solar electricity to offset all of its annual electricity consumption. Operating independently from the grid at all times generally requires sufficient battery storage and enough solar capacity for periods of low production. Energy efficiency can reduce the number of panels and batteries required. Many solar-powered homes remain connected to the grid for backup electricity.

Why is it difficult to sell a house with solar panels in Antioch?

Selling a home with solar panels can become more complicated when the system is leased, financed, or subject to a power purchase agreement. Buyers may need to assume or qualify for an existing contract, adding steps to the transaction. Owned systems with clear documentation are generally simpler to transfer. System age, roof condition, and remaining warranty coverage can also affect buyer decisions.
